The cheapest way to get from Heswall to Halewood is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 37 min.
The fastest way to get from Heswall to Halewood is to taxi which takes 37 min and costs £35 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Heswall station to Halewood. However, there are services departing from Heswall Bus Station and arriving at Church Road via Ranelagh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 48m.
The distance between Heswall and Halewood is 55 miles. The road distance is 17.2 miles.
The best way to get from Heswall to Halewood without a car is to bus and line 79 bus which takes 1h 48m and costs £5 - £7.
It takes approximately 1h 48m to get from Heswall to Halewood, including transfers.
Heswall to Halewood bus services, operated by Arriva UK, depart from Heswall Bus Station.
Heswall to Halewood bus services, operated by Arriva UK, arrive at Hood street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Heswall to Halewood is 17 miles. It takes approximately 37 min to drive from Heswall to Halewood.
